Old Turkic
editEtymology 1
editLetter
edit𐰪 (ń)
- A letter of the Old Turkic runic script, representing /ɲ/
Etymology 2
editInherited from Proto-Turkic *ań- (“to fear”). Cognate with Mongolian айх (ajx).
Verb
edit𐰪 (ań-)
- (intransitive) to fear
- 8th century CE, Tonyukuk Inscription, IIS1
- 𐰪𐰯:𐱃𐰍𐰴𐰀:𐱅𐰔𐰃𐰚:𐱃𐰸𐰺𐰽𐰃𐰤
- ańïp:taɣqa:tezik:toqarsïn
- ...Having feared the Arabic tribes and Tocharians...
- 8th century CE, Tonyukuk Inscription, IIS1
